Quick Chicken & Broccoli Stir-Fry Ingredients
For the Sauce
- Rice Vinegar – Adds acidity and brightness; can substitute with white vinegar for a similar tang.
- Mirin – Sweet rice wine that enriches the sauce; consider using a mild, sweet white wine or extra sugar if needed.
- Chili Garlic Sauce – Provides a delicious heat; reduce the amount for a milder flavor or utilize hot sauce instead.
- Cornstarch – Thickens the sauce effectively; remember to mix with liquid to prevent clumping.
- Soy Sauce – Infuses umami flavor into the dish; tamari works for a gluten-free version.
- Fish Sauce – Deepens the savory notes; if unavailable, additional soy sauce is a suitable substitute.
For the Stir-Fry
- Chicken Broth – Adds moisture and flavor; vegetable broth is a great option for a vegetarian version.
- Instant Brown Rice – Serves as a hearty base; for even quicker preparation, use microwaveable rice.
- Sesame Oil – Imparts a wonderful nutty flavor; you can switch to vegetable oil if allergic.
- Broccoli Florets – The star vegetable, offering crunch and nutrition; substitute with mixed stir-fry veggies if desired.
- Cubed Cooked Chicken – Provides a hearty source of protein; swap with tofu for a vegetarian variation.
- Green Onions – Adds a splash of freshness and crunch; if unavailable, chives make a fine substitute.

How to Make Quick Chicken & Broccoli Stir-Fry
-
Mix the Sauce: In a small bowl, combine rice vinegar, mirin, chili garlic sauce, cornstarch, soy sauce, fish sauce, and 1/4 cup of chicken broth. Whisk until smooth and set aside for later use.
-
Cook the Rice: Prepare instant brown rice according to package instructions. This usually takes about 10 minutes and gives you a perfect base for your stir-fry.
-
Heat the Oil: In a large skillet or wok, heat sesame oil over medium-high heat. You want the oil shimmering before adding any ingredients for that delightful stir-fry sizzle.
-
Stir-Fry the Broccoli: Add the broccoli florets and stir-fry for about 2 minutes until they turn a vibrant green. This short cooking time keeps them crisp and fresh!
-
Add Broth: Pour in the remaining chicken broth and cook for another 1-2 minutes until the broccoli is crisp-tender. This helps to steam the broccoli while it absorbs the broth’s flavor.
-
Incorporate the Sauce: Stir in the sauce mixture and bring to a boil. Cook for another 1-2 minutes, stirring frequently until the sauce thickens and clings beautifully to the veggies.
-
Combine with Chicken: Finally, mix in the cubed cooked chicken and chopped green onions. Heat it through for a couple of minutes, ensuring everything is lovingly coated in that savory sauce, then serve it hot over the cooked rice.
Optional: Garnish with a sprinkle of sesame seeds for an extra touch and a nutty flavor.

Storage Tips for Quick Chicken & Broccoli Stir-Fry
Fridge: Store leftovers in an airtight container for up to 3 days to maintain freshness. Allow to cool before refrigerating to avoid condensation.
Freezer: To freeze, cool the stir-fry completely, then transfer it to a freezer-safe container. It can last for up to 2 months.
Reheating: For best results, reheat in a skillet over medium heat for 5-7 minutes until thoroughly heated. You can add a splash of broth to rehydrate the sauce if needed.

Expert Tips for Quick Chicken & Broccoli Stir-Fry
-
Uniform Broccoli: Ensure your broccoli florets are cut into similar sizes for even cooking and consistent texture throughout the dish.
-
Heat Control: Stir-fry on medium-high heat for that perfect balance of crispness in the veggies and tenderness in the chicken, avoiding overcooking.
-
Custom Spice Levels: Start with less chili garlic sauce if you’re unsure about spice, and add more gradually until it reaches your desired heat level.
-
Crowding the Pan: Avoid crowding the skillet when cooking; it can lead to steaming instead of stir-frying, making your ingredients less crisp and flavorful.

What if my stir-fry is too watery?
If you find your Quick Chicken & Broccoli Stir-Fry is too watery, don’t worry! You can remediate this by combining a teaspoon of cornstarch with a tablespoon of cold water to create a slurry. Slowly stir it into the warm stir-fry while it’s cooking over medium heat. Cook for another minute or two until the sauce thickens to your desired consistency.
